    Maybe, but if it is raised then why is the 1 so weak that it is barely visible ?

    Lighting effects can often make incuse look to be raised, and vice versa. Which is why I asked.My thinking is that this is possibly a strike-through error, and that would explain why the 1 is so weak.

    Were it a plating bubble and the 1 was struck directly on top of that bubble, then the bubble, which would be several times thinner than a sheet of paper, should have been broken by the strike. But is not, so that is one other thing that makes me wonder.
